Block 18739109

0x7e3362c1d2bcb60f20d05af58078819c36d539e8f8f885a9e50817bbcd76d5fe
Transactions0
Height18739109
Confirmations1435485
TimestampSat, 18 Nov 2023 00:27:08 UTC
Size (bytes)546
Version
Merkle Root
Nonce0x0e45488826b2f583
Bits
Difficulty0x6f83bed66a475